1. Introduction
Congratulations with your purchase of this Programmable power outlet strip. Your EG-SMS is an advanced power outlet strip with power management features. Four sockets are individually manageable via the GSM interface.
The sockets can be switched on/off by a timer schedule, by user or different events. It is also possible to pre-program the unit event timer schedule (hardware schedule) and then disconnect EG-SMS from GSM network and use it elsewhere. The device can be used as an advanced standby-killer.
1.1. Features
• The main rocker switch enables switching all the sockets on and off
- In addition to it every manageable socket can be switched on and off via the software control window or SMS
- The unit can be pre-programmed via hardware-based schedule. The hardware schedule will work even when the managing computer is switched off
- The unit will keep performing the programmed hardware time schedule even after EG-SMS is disconnected from the power for some time (up to 4 hours)
energenie
EG-SMS PROGRAMMABLE POWER OUTLET STRIP WITH GSM INTERFACE
- The manageable sockets can then be switched on and off by the schedule, simple typical applications could be: “switch my peripherals on every working day at 8:50 AM” etc
- 64-bit password protected secure access
- External sensors: water (normally opened contact), locker (normally closed contact), temperature can be connected for it's monitoring, sending alarms and switching the sockets (optional, not included)

2.2. Indicators
- Main rocker switch (Figure #1) is lit – this means that EG-SMS is connected to the power supply and active
- The indicator Socket 1 (2,3,4) (Figure #1) is lit – this means that this particular socket is switched on
- The green indicator Network status (Figure #2) blinks quickly – searching the network; blinks once in 3 seconds – connected to the network; permanently on – device is initializing after power on
- The red indicator Schedule status (Figure #2) is on – a schedule is present; off – schedule is absent; blinks up to 4 times – SMS is just received

3.1. Getting started
- Connect EG-SMS to the wall socket first and connect the GSM antenna.
- EG-SMS can now be switched on and off by means of the Main rocker switch.
- Two (the first and the last) sockets of EG-SMS are marked with the symbol 📄. These two sockets are switched on and off by means of the Main rocker switch and cannot be managed by the computer – so they are called non-manageable sockets in this manual.
- If EG-SMS is switched on then the red indicator POWER is lit. In this case both non-manageable sockets are now live and connected to the power supply.
- The sockets: Socket 1, Socket 2, Socket 3 and Socket 4 can be managed or pre-programmed via GSM. They are called manageable sockets in this manual.
- The manageable sockets of EG-SMS can be programmed to be on or off. The current status of each manageable socket is represented by the corresponding indicator which will be lit if socket has power to it.
- If the Main rocker switch (Figure #1) is turned off then the manageable sockets cannot be switched on via either GSM or the hardware schedule.
- As soon as you turn the Main rocker switch (Z) on then it is be able to turn the manageable sockets on and off.
- Password button (Figure #2) When this button is pressed, the new password, which is received in incoming password SMS, will be applied. See Clause.3.3 or 5 for setting the password
- To protect the connected devices from possible high current and short circuit EG-SMS is equipped with the automatic circuit breaker, which is embedded in the Main rocker switch.
- When EG-SMS is powered off or disconnected from power mains it stays connected the GSM network and accessible via SMS for some hours (2-4 hours) because of Lilon battery. After the battery is discharged it becomes inaccessible until it is powered on. When battery is discharged, the device shall be kept in power on state for some 12 hours for full restore the battery charge.
NOTE: If the total power consumption (or peak power) of the devices, connected to EG-SMS exceeds 2200 Watts, the circuit breaker may power EG-SMS off. In this case, please, remove the excessive load
first and then press the Main rocker switch on to restore the power supply (Figure #3).

3.3. Initial configuration
Insert the SIM card into device. Connect the antenna. Place the device in the area with good signal of current GSM network. Connect the device into power mains. Switch on the device. Network indicator shall start blinking fast, and after some seconds will start blinking once in 3 seconds. It means that device is on and registered in the GSM network. Press button “Password” and hold.
All brands and logos are registered trademarks of their respective owners
Send password SMS from mobile phone to the mobile number of the device. This SMS shall contain only with 8-symbols password.
Characters shall be english, all are allowed except “+” symbol. When the device received SMS, “Schedule” indicator will blink 4 times. Now release the “Password” button. Shortly after that an SMS with same password will be received by the mobile phone. Access password is successfully applied. The device is ready to work.
4. Operating EG-SMS with simple mobile phone by SMS
4.1 Controlling the sockets.
Send SMS with text:
PASSWORD200A0B0C0D
PASSWORD – access password
A,B,C,D – control for socket 1,2,3,4 respectively. Shall be 1 to switch the socket ON, or 0 to switch the socket off.
The device will switch sockets and send the response SMS to the mobile phone with new statuses of sockets:
SWITCH SOCKETS: ON OFF OFF ON, POWER OK
All brands and logos are registered trademarks of their respective owners
SWITCH – response to the SWITCH command ON/OFF – socket state for socket 1..4 respectively POWER OK – power from power mains is present
Example SMS: Gembird12001000001
Device action: switch Socket1 ON, Socket2 OFF, Socket3 OFF, Socket4 ON, Gembird1 is password.
Response SMS:
SWITCH SOCKETS: ON OFF OFF ON, POWER OK
4.2 Using alarms by WATER, LOCKER, TEMPERATURE sensors
First, enable sensors needed by command Enable/Disable sensors. For temperature alarm set the temperature limits, over which the alarm will be issued. Time on device can be set on this command. It is not necessary to set, it is needed for running the hardware schedule only, which can be set by Power Manager software, see Clause 3.2 for details.
PASSWORD000A0B0C0DSLLLSHHHTTTTTTTT
A-TEMPERATURE sensor B-LOCKER sensor
All brands and logos are registered trademarks of their respective owners
C-WATER sensor
D-Response SMS for all commands, except alarm and password response commands
Value: 1-Enable, 0-Disable
SLLL– low temperature limit, in degrees C. S is sign – or +.
Example: -001 equals to -1 degree C.
SHHH – high temperature limit, in degrees C
TTTTTTTT –inversion timestamp, hexadecimal coded, in seconds. It's time since Jan,1 1970, 00:00:00. Example: 5179191D equals to Thu, 25 Apr 2013 11:52:44 GMT. ( Time stamp is optional for input ).
TTTTTTTTT=1D197951
Note: If EG-SMS is powered off for some hours (more than 2 hours) internal timer can be timed out. Then it shall be set again by this SMS.
When the corresponding sensor is enabled, it issues alarm
For Temperature sensor alarm is issued once when temperature exceeds high limit or below low limit. For LOCKER sensor alarm is issued once, when contact is opened. For WATER sensor alarm is issued once, when contact is closed.
Alarm SMS (example):
STATUS SOCKETS: ON OFF OFF ON, LOCKER ALARM, WATER ALARM, TEMP +14C ALARM, NO POWER
For clearing all alarms send SMS to the device: PASSWORD03
Response SMS: ALARMS CLEARED
4.3 Control socket autonomously by WATER, LOCKER, TEMPERATURE sensors
First, enable the corresponding sensors and set temperature limits, as it is written in p4.2.
For controlling the socket by sensors use the following command.
It ties socket to sensors and controls it according to the current status of the sensor or temperature range. The device doesn't issue any alarm SMS, when sensor changes it's state or temperature is out of limits. This temperature limits are independent from limits in alarm section.
PASSWORD500A0B0CSLLLSHHH0F0G0H0I
A – Socket number, 0 for Socket 1, 1 for Socket 2, etc.
B - Temperature sensor is controlling the socket. 1 - yes, 0 - no
C – Socket control, when temperature is within the limits.
1 – Socket ON, 0 – Socket OFF
All brands and logos are registered trademarks of their respective owners
SLLL– low temperature limit, in degrees C. S is sign – or +.
Example: -001 equals to -1 degree C.
SHHH – high temperature limit, in degrees C
F - LOCKER sensor is controlling the socket. 1 - yes, 0 - no
G – Socket control, when LOCKER is opened (contact is open).
1 – Socket ON, 0 – Socket OFF
H - WATER sensor is controlling the socket. 1 – yes, 0 - no
G – Socket control, when WATER is present (contact is closed).
1 – Socket ON, 0 – Socket OFF
Response SMS:
500A0B0CSLLLSHHH0F0G0H0I
Example SMS:
Gembird150000101+000+03400000000
This command controls the Socket 1 ON when temperature drops below 0 or rises higher 34 deg C, and controls it OFF when temperature returns within these limits.

4.4 Monitoring socket sensor states
This SMS message gives response SMS with statuses of all sockets and enabled sensors:
PASSWORD10
Response SMS (example):
STATUS SOCKETS: ON OFF OFF ON, LOCKER ALARM, WATER ALARM, TEMP +14C OK, NO POWER
All brands and logos are registered trademarks of their respective owners
4.5 Monitoring enable/disable sensor
This SMS message gives response SMS with information about enabled/disabled sensors, response sms, temperature limits and device timestamp:
PASSWORD11
Response SMS (example):
SENSOR SET: TEMP ON, LOCKER ON, WATER ON, ACKNOWLEDGE ON, RANGE+005+030, TIME78563412
This sms mean that TEMPERATURE sensor enabled, LOCKER sensor enabled, WATER sensor enabled, Response SMS enabled, low temperature limit +5 degrees C, high temperature limit +30 degrees C, device timestamp – 12345678.

- Troubleshooting
| Problem | Solution |
| The main rocker switch is off automatically. | The load connected to the device is too high, some of the devices connected to the EG-SMS should be disconnected. |
| The switching command is not carried out, the rocker switch is lit. | 1) There is no power supply to the EG-SMS and battery is exhausted. Make sure the EG-SMS is connected to the power supply and the rocker switch is switched on.2) No SIM-card or SIM-card is broken. Replace the SIM-card with good one.3) Password is not set well. Set the password.4) Mobile operator may process SMS messages with a delay – wait, please.5) Make sure SIM-card has sufficient money balance for receiving and sending SMS. |
| Wrong info about the device, or it's sockets, no info updates. Sockets are switched by Power Manager app well. | Android has other application processing the SMS messages, which interphere with Power Manager application. Temporarily remove other external SMS processing apps. |
